如果一个全局变量没有用常量表达式来初始化,那么会首先将其初始化为0。 阶段2:动态初始化 例如上面的x = y就是动态初始化了。 也就是说,c++程序在启动时,首先会进行静态初始化,然后再进行动态初始化。 对于例2,y=3会在静态初始化阶段执行,而x = y在后面执行,所以最后y值为3,x值也为3。 所以对于例1来...
数值6类 (long/int/short/byte)(double/float) 非数值2类(char,boolean) 下面是默认值: 0/0/0/0/0.0/0.0/ /false 首先Java 语言就是这么规定的。 然后为什么 Java 语言要这么规定呢?有什么内部机理吗? 可能的原因如下,当我们新建一个对象时,Java会在Heap中申请一块内存区域用以存放类的数据。而成员变量...
app designer 初始化全局变量默认值 ... 1.的对于不同编译单位的,其 # Java属性是全局变量初始化值在Java编程中,属性是类中的全局变量,它们定义了对象的状态和特征。当我们创建一个对象时,每个属性都会有一个 全局变量初始化在Python中,我们经常会使用类来组织代码并创建对象。在类中,我们有时需要定义一些全局变...
全局变量未初始化计算机默认值为 。如何将EXCEL生成题库手机刷题 如何制作自己的在线小题库 > 手机使用 分享 反馈 收藏 举报 参考答案: 0 复制 纠错举一反三 依据《企业职工伤亡事故分类》(GB 41) 进行分类的危险和有害因素中,触电是指电流流经人体,造成生理伤害的事故。适用于触电、雷击伤害。如人体接触带电...
全局变量aBoolean默认值:false 全局变量ints默认值:null 全局变量char默认值为空 1. 2. 3. 4. 5. 6. 7. 8. 9. 2.成员变量 public class MembereVar { private char aChar; private int anInt; private long aLong; private float aFloat;
下面是默认值: 0/0/0/0/0.0/0.0/ /false 首先Java 语言就是这么规定的。 然后为什么 Java 语言要这么规定呢?有什么内部机理吗? 可能的原因如下,当我们新建一个对象时,Java会在Heap中申请一块内存区域用以存放类的数据。而成员变量就是类的数据,也是放在这块内存区域中的。只需要JVM在申请内存的时候顺便把整块...